On 19/11/2014 14:57, Juan Quintela wrote:
> > Shipping a separate BIOS for different machine types is unrealistic and
> > pointless.  It would also be a good terrain for bug reports, unless you
> > also do things like "forbid creating -device megasas-gen2 on 2.1 because
> > it was introduced in 2.2".
>
> And I agree with that.  If it got introduced on 2.2, it should not be
> allowed on pc-2.1.  It just makes things more complicated.  We don't
> have infrastructure to enforce that.  And I am claining that is the
> problem.  We are just papering over this problem each time that it
> happens.  I honestely think that the only way to really fix
> compatibility is enforcing that machine types are stable.  right now
> they are now, and we ended nothing it.

Weird, I have bought this USB device last month and I plugged it into a
two-year-old laptop.

    QEMU version = when did I last update firmware / buy hardware
    Machine type = when did I buy the computer

I honestly think that you are talking out of design dogma, without
really thinking through the consequences of the design.
